Kidneys for Taylyn fundraiser race

Submitted by emy.porter on

In 2022, Taylyn Healey (9) contracted Henoch-Schonlein purpura (HSP, also known as IgA vasculitis), a disease that causes the small blood vessels in their skin, joints, intestines and kidneys to become inflamed and bleed. Taylyn has had a serious case of the disease, along with other problems and has already had to have her kidneys removed from her body. Taylyn undergoes dialysis three times a week and will need a kidney transplant in the near future.
